Correlation power analysis(CPA)combined with genetic algorithms(GA)now achieves greater attack efficiency and can recover all subkeys ***,two issues in GA-based CPA still need to be addressed:key degeneration and slow evolution within *** challenges significantly hinder key recovery *** paper proposes a screening correlation power analysis framework combined with a genetic algorithm,named SFGA-CPA,to address these ***-CPA introduces three operations designed to exploit CPA characteris-tics:propagative operation,constrained crossover,and constrained ***,the propagative operation accelerates population evolution by maximizing the number of correct bytes in each ***,the constrained crossover and mutation operations effectively address key degeneration by preventing the compromise of correct ***,an intelligent search method is proposed to identify optimal parameters,further improving attack *** were conducted on both simulated environments and real power traces collected from the SAKURA-G *** the case of simulation,SFGA-CPA reduces the number of traces by 27.3%and 60%compared to CPA based on multiple screening methods(MS-CPA)and CPA based on simple GA method(SGA-CPA)when the success rate reaches 90%.Moreover,real experimental results on the SAKURA-G platform demonstrate that our approach outperforms other methods.
